Most Common

Swing shower door

A fixed panel plus a hinged door. The cleanest look for a typical shower opening. Hinges mount glass-to-wall, glass-to-glass, or ceiling/floor.

For wider openings

Sliding or barn door slider

Two panels on a top track. Best when the opening is wider than what a swing door comfortably handles, or when there isn't room outside the shower for a door to clear.

walk-in / curbless

Single fixed panel

One pane, no door. The most architectural option, especially with a curbless entry. Requires a long enough wet-zone that the splash stays in the shower.

Corner Installs

Neo-angle

Multi-sided enclosure that tucks into a corner. Smart use of square footage in smaller bathrooms, and the angled front face reads more architectural than a square corner stall.

glass coatings

Easier to clean. Clearer for longer.

Untreated glass shower doors eventually cloud: minerals from the water bond to the surface and a squeegee stops being enough. A baked-in coating fuses a permanent, non-stick layer into the glass, so water beads off and the surface stays clear for the life of the enclosure.

Recommended    Baked-in protection


Applied at the factory under heat and pressure while the glass is being made, so the coating is fused into the surface itself, not laid on top. It can't wear off, peel, or be cleaned away, and it carries a manufacturer lifetime warranty. We spec Guardian ShowerGuard, the baked-in coating we trust most for our water.

Middle TN water     Clarity that lasts


Hard water is the reality across Williamson County and Nashville. On untreated glass, minerals bond to the surface within a year and a squeegee stops being enough, leaving the cloudy film that dulls an enclosure. A baked-in coating is built for exactly that.


  • Keeps its clarity and color. The glass looks as clear as on install day, not hazed and gray.
  • Protects the surface. The non-stick layer keeps minerals and soap from etching in.
  • Beads water off. Water sheets off and soap rinses clean instead of drying into spots.

  • When during the build does the custom frameless shower glass get measured?

    After tile is set, grout is cured, and the shower head and valve are in. Before paint touch-up if you can swing it. We measure to the finished surfaces because every custom frameless shower enclosure is built specifically for your completed opening. Measuring earlier usually means re-measuring later.

  • What if my walls aren't perfectly plumb for a frameless shower door installation?

    They almost never are. That's exactly what the field measure is for. We measure with a digital level from top to bottom and cut the glass to match the wall as it actually is. A wall that's out a quarter-inch over seven feet is normal. Every custom frameless shower door is fabricated to fit your specific opening, so the reveals stay tight and the door still swings true.
